歡迎來到Linux教程網
Linux教程網
Linux教程網
Linux教程網
Linux教程網 >> Linux基礎 >> 關於Linux >> liunx 定時備份mysql任務實現代碼

liunx 定時備份mysql任務實現代碼

日期:2017/3/2 10:06:39   编辑:關於Linux

mysql_bak.sh文件內容如下

#!/bin/bash
#/usr/local/mysql/bin/mysqldump -uroot -proot -c --hex-blob --quick --default-character-set=GB2312 -B xx > /home/bak/db/sql_xx_`date +%y%m%d`.sql
day=`date -d'-7 day' +'%d'`
#保留7天的備份,並保留每個月1日的備份
if [ "$day" != "01" ]; then
rm -rf /home/bak/db/sql_bsoa-ezoa_`date -d'-7 day' +'%y%m%d'`.sql

fi

2.在liunx中加入定時任務

3.給mysql_bak.sh可以執行的權限

Copyright © Linux教程網 All Rights Reserved